While creating an MTD VAT return, you may receive a "Unauthorised" status. This typically occurs when HMRC’s authorisation (OAuth token) has expired, preventing the application from successfully interacting with HMRC. To resolve this issue, you need to revoke the existing authorisation and reauthorise your entity with HMRC. Follow the steps below.
1. Navigate to the Entity section from the left-hand panel of the application.
2. Locate the entity name for which you need to revoke authorisation. Click on the "Revoke" button next to the entity name. This action will remove the expired authorisation.
3. After revoking, you will see an "Authorise" button. Click on this button to initiate the reauthorisation process. You will be redirected to the HMRC authorisation page.
4. Enter your HMRC login credentials on the HMRC sign-in page. Click on "Grant Authority" and follow the on-screen instructions to complete the authorisation process.
Make sure that you are using the HMRC credentials assigned to the specific entity you want to authorise. If the credentials do not correspond to the correct VAT Registration Number (VRN), interactions with HMRC through the application will not be successful.
5. Once the authorisation is successfully re-established, you can proceed to create and submit your VAT return without encountering the "Unauthorised" status.
